Population & Demographics

The following information lists the population statistics and breakdown for the 46501 zip code. The total population is 3697, of which, 1789 are male and 1908 are female. With a total area of 181.558 square miles, the population density is 19.9 people per square mile. The median age of the population is 38.6 years old. Income & Economic Characteristics

The median inflation-adjusted family income in the 46501 zip code is $61328. This is -17.93% less than the national average. This income places 8.8% of the population below the poverty line. The average retirement income for individuals in this zip code (for those that have it) is $13354. Education

In the 46501 zip code, 81.5% of individuals over 25 years old have a high school degree or higher, and 12.4% have a bachelors degree or higher. Occupation and Work Characteristics

In the 46501 zip, there are an estimated 1907 people in the labor force, of which, 1841 are employed, and 66 are unemployed. There are a total of 0 people in the armed forces. The average commute time for this zip code is 25 minutes. Of the total people that work, 88 worked from home and 1805 commuted. The average number of hours worked is 38.4. Housing

The median home value for the 46501 zip code is 107000. There is an estimated  1268 number of occupied housing units, the median gross rent in is $845 per month, and the average monthly housing costs are estimated to be $800.
